Power outlet rep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ues related to electrical outlets in residential or commercial properties. These services typically address problems such as outlets that are not functioning, outlets that are loose or wobbly, or outlets that have visible damage. Repair work may include replacing faulty outlets, tightening connections, or updating outdated wiring to ensure the outlets operate safely and reliably. Skilled service providers focus on restoring proper power flow and preventing potential electrical hazards that can arise from malfunctioning outlets.

Many common electrical problems can be resolved through outlet repair services. For example, if an outlet sparks when plugged in, frequently trips circuit breakers, or fails to supply power to connected devices, professional repair can often identify and correct the underlying issue. Problems like frequent electrical surges, outlets that are warm to the touch, or outlets that have become discolored or damaged are signs that repairs are needed. Addressing these issues promptly can help prevent more serious electrical failures and reduce the risk of fire or shock hazards.

The overview below groups typical Power Outlet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Basic outlet repairs or replacements typically cost between $100 and $250 for many routine jobs. Most projects in this range involve straightforward fixes that local contractors can complete quickly. Fewer jobs extend into higher price ranges, which usually involve additional work or older wiring issues.

Moderate Repairs - Replacing multiple outlets or upgrading existing wiring generally falls between $250 and $600. Many service providers handle projects in this middle range, which includes standard upgrades and repairs for homes or small commercial spaces. Larger, more complex projects can reach $1,000+ in some cases.

Full Outlet Replacement - Complete replacement of outlets across a room or entire property can cost from $600 to $1,200 depending on the number of outlets and wiring complexity. Most jobs in this category are routine replacements, but extensive rewiring can push costs higher.

Major Electrical Overhaul - Large-scale projects such as rewiring a whole building or major system upgrades can cost $2,500 or more. These projects are less common and typically involve extensive work, with many smaller jobs falling into lower price brackets.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a power outlet needs repair? Signs include outlets that are not functioning, sparking or burning smells, frequent tripping of circuit breakers, or outlets that feel warm to the touch.

Can a damaged outlet pose safety risks? Yes, damaged outlets can increase the risk of electrical shocks, fires, or further electrical system issues if not repaired promptly by qualified service providers.

What types of power outlet repairs do local contractors typically handle? They can fix or replace faulty outlets, address wiring issues, upgrade outlets for safety or convenience, and troubleshoot electrical problems related to outlets.

Are there different repair options for various types of outlets? Yes, repair options may vary depending on the outlet type, such as standard, GFCI, or specialized outlets, and local service providers can recommend suitable solutions.
